Real-World Testing: Putting the Ezr Grips AR15/AR10 Rifle Grip Dark Earth No Finger Index to the Test

First Use Experience

My initial testing of this grip took place primarily at the range, specifically during a longer-than-usual carbine course. I swapped out the existing grip on my AR-15 in my home workshop before heading out. The installation itself was straightforward, requiring just a few minutes and a standard screwdriver.

The grip performed admirably under consistent firing. I experienced no slippage, even after several hours of shooting and a brief, light drizzle that made the range a bit damp. Its texture provided a secure purchase without being overly aggressive, which is a common pitfall with some aggressive grip patterns.

One minor quirk I noticed immediately was the absence of finger grooves; while this was an intentional design choice, it took a few magazines to fully adjust my hand placement for optimal comfort compared to grips I’d used previously. However, this adjustment period was brief and didn’t detract significantly from the overall experience.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several months and countless trips to the range, this grip has proven itself to be remarkably reliable. It’s been subjected to dust, occasional impacts (it once took a tumble onto a concrete bench during a hasty gear change), and significant temperature fluctuations without any degradation in performance or appearance.

The Sorbothane material, as specified, has held up exceptionally well. There are no signs of cracking, excessive wear, or stiffness. Cleaning is as simple as wiping it down with a damp cloth or a mild degreaser if necessary, and it dries quickly.

Compared to some budget grips I’ve used in the past, which often develop a “tacky” feel or start to harden, this model feels as good as the day I installed it. It doesn’t boast the custom-molded feel of much more expensive, specialized grips, but for its intended purpose and price point, its durability is commendable.

Breaking Down the Features of the Ezr Grips AR15/AR10 Rifle Grip Dark Earth No Finger Index

Specifications

The Ezr Grips AR15/AR10 Rifle Grip Dark Earth No Finger Index is constructed from Sorbothane, a synthetic polymer known for its shock-absorbing and vibration-dampening properties. This material choice is a significant factor in the grip’s comfortable feel. The grip comes in a striking Dark Earth color, offering a subdued yet distinct aesthetic.

Crucially, it is designed with No Finger Grooves, a deliberate design decision that allows for more adaptable hand placement. It also features No Checkering, relying on the inherent texture of the Sorbothane for grip. As specified, this is an AR15/AR10 rifle grip and it specifically lacks a finger index.

The material and lack of aggressive texture contribute to a surprisingly comfortable feel during extended handling. This contrasts with many grips that incorporate aggressive checkering or deeply molded finger grooves, which can sometimes feel abrasive or restrictive over time. The Sorbothane offers a unique balance of grip and comfort.

Durability & Maintenance

Based on my extended testing, this grip is built for longevity. The Sorbothane material is inherently durable and resistant to degradation from common environmental factors. I anticipate this grip will last for many thousands of rounds, if not the lifespan of the rifle itself, under typical shooting conditions.

Maintenance is refreshingly simple. A quick wipe-down with a damp cloth is usually sufficient to keep it clean. For more stubborn grime, a mild soap or a general-purpose cleaner can be used without issue. The material does not absorb liquids readily, which aids in its ease of cleaning.

I haven’t encountered any specific failure points or areas of concern. The only potential issue for some might be the long-term adhesion of the grip to the receiver extension, but this is a general concern with any A2-style grip and not specific to this particular model.
